Learn R Programming

⚠️There's a newer version (2.0.0) of this package.Take me there.

MetaLandSim (version 1.0.4)

Landscape and Range Expansion Simulation

Description

Tools to generate random landscape graphs, evaluate species occurrence in dynamic landscapes, simulate future landscape occupation and evaluate range expansion when new empty patches are available (e.g. as a result of climate change).

Copy Link

Version

Install

install.packages('MetaLandSim')

Monthly Downloads

311

Version

1.0.4

License

GPL (>= 2)

Maintainer

Frederico Mestre

Last Published

June 17th, 2018

Functions in MetaLandSim (1.0.4)

accept.calculate

Calculate acceptance rates in MCMC chains
import.shape

Import a shapefile
convert.graph

Convert data frame to landscape
iterate.graph

Simulate landscape series occupation
metapopulation

Class 'metapopulation'
MetaLandSim-internal

Internal functions for the MetaLandSim package.
metrics.graph

Computes landscape connectivity metrics
plot_expansion

Graphical display of the expansion
landscape

Class 'landscape'
min_distance

Computes topological distance
plot_graph

Graphical display of the landscape
range_expansion

Produce a range expansion model
remove.species

Remove the species occupancy from the landscape
coda.create

Create files for use with R-package coda.
cabrera

Modified patch occupancy data of Cabrera vole
range_raster

Probability of occupancy, dispersal model
calcmode

Function for mode estimation of a continuous variable
combine.chains

Combines two chains into a single chain.
ifm.missing.MCMC

Estimate the 'missing' design incidence function model
removepoints

Remove a given number of patches from the landscape
MetaLandSim.GUI

Graphic User Interface
summary_landscape

Summarize 'landscape' class objects
MetaLandSim-package

Landscape And Range Expansion Simulation
create.parameter.df

Create parameter data frame
extract.graph

Extract landscape from span.graph generated list
expansion

Class 'expansion'
ifm.naive.MCMC

Estimate the naive design incidence function model
matrix.graph

Returning a matrix with information on connections between patches
edge.graph

Produce an edge (links) data frame
manage_expansion_sim

Simulate range expansion simulation
summary_metapopulation

Summarize 'metapopulation' class objects
manage_landscape_sim

Batch landscape simulation
param1

Sample parameter data frame number 1
mc_df

Modified patch occupancy data of Cabrera vole as a data frame
landscape_change

Landscape loosing 5% of patches per time step
param2

Sample parameter data frame number 2
parameter.estimate

Estimate parameters
plotL.graph

Plot one landscape of the list created by span.graph
list.stats

Returning information on a dynamic landscape list
occ.landscape2

Sample landscape with 10 simulated occupancy snapshots
occ.landscape

Sample landscape with one simulated occupancy snapshot
span.graph

Simulate landscape dynamics over a number of time steps
rland.graph

Creates random landscape graph
simulate_graph

Simulate species occupancy in one dynamic landscape
simulatedifm

Set of simulated data to use with the IFM parameter estimation functions. The data were generated using the code provided in "details".
species.graph

Simulate landscape occupation
spom

Stochastic Patch Occupancy Model
rg_exp

List with range.expansion output
rland

Random landscape
cluster.graph

Delivers the number of patches per cluster
cluster.id

Classify patches in clusters
addpoints

Add a given number of patches to a landscape
components.graph

Number of components of a landscape
ifm.robust.MCMC

Estimate the robust design incidence function model